Tarran Mackenzie says he doesn’t want to be known as just a wet weather rider in WorldSBK.
Despite Tarran Mackenzie’s impressive fourth place finish at the Australian WorldSBK, it led to an undesired reputation as a “wet weather rider.” Mackenzie has shown skill in rainy conditions before, such as his wins in World Supersport and top-10 finishes in wet races last year. However, he is determined to prove his abilities in dry conditions and move away from this label. Mackenzie attributes his comfort in the rain to his smooth riding style and perhaps his UK origins, where rain is common. Although pleased with his fourth place, he expressed disappointment with his performance in the Superpole Race and aims to improve his results in dry conditions.
